Tip 1: How to measure room temperature using a smartphone
Step 1: Notes when measuring room temperature using a thermometer app on your phone.
Thermometer apps on phones are often inaccurate.
Most smartphones today do not have sensors to measure ambient temperature .
-
The internal sensors only monitor battery temperature , so they are easily affected by the heat emitted from the phone itself.
-
Therefore, thermometer apps on iPhones or Android devices only give estimated results, which are often significantly different from the actual room temperature.
-
Only when the phone has a dedicated environmental sensor will the app be able to take more accurate measurements.

The number of smartphones with actual temperature sensors is decreasing because this feature is difficult to manufacture and few users need it.

Step 2: How to use a separate temperature sensor to accurately measure room temperature.
Connect your phone to a temperature sensor or mini weather station.
For much more accurate results than a thermometer app, you should use a separate temperature sensor or weather station connected to your phone.
-
Choose a device that supports WiFi or Bluetooth for direct data transfer.
-
Many sensor models can also measure humidity , air quality , outdoor temperature , etc., helping you comprehensively monitor your living environment.
-
Download the accompanying app to view real-time data and customize settings directly on your phone.
Advantages and disadvantages of the two types of connections
-
WiFi devices: more expensive but allow you to view data from anywhere, even if you're not near the sensor.
-
Bluetooth devices: cheaper, but the phone needs to be close to the device to connect.
Extended functionality when using external sensors.
-
Many models can connect with Amazon Alexa or Google Home , allowing you to view room temperature by voice or sync with your smart home system.

Tip 2: How to use a thermometer to check room temperature
Step 1: Use an electronic thermometer to measure the room temperature as accurately as possible.
Advantages of electronic thermometers
Electronic thermometers are the most reliable option when you need to measure room temperature accurately .
-
It responds quickly to changes in air conditions, providing almost instantaneous measurements.
-
Higher accuracy compared to glass thermometers or bimetallic thermometers.
-
Stable operation, minimally affected by surrounding environmental factors.
Extended features of some electronic thermometer models
-
Recording temperature data hourly or daily helps you track changes in room temperature over time.
-
Some devices also display humidity levels or warn you when the temperature exceeds a threshold you've set.
When should you choose an electronic thermometer?
-
When you need high precision to control the environment in a bedroom, children's room, or office.
-
When you want to review the temperature history to adjust your air conditioner, heater, or ventilation more effectively.

Step 2: Use a glass thermometer to measure the room temperature as an approximate value.
How glass thermometers work
Glass thermometers (also known as bulb thermometers or liquid thermometers ) use a thin glass tube containing liquid inside.
-
As the temperature rises, the liquid expands and rises in the tube.
-
As the temperature decreases, the liquid contracts and sinks.
-
This is a traditional measurement mechanism, simple and easy to observe with the naked eye.
Important considerations when choosing a glass thermometer.
-
Choose a mercury-free thermometer, as mercury is toxic and dangerous if it breaks.
-
Prioritize using colored alcohol or safe liquids to avoid risks to your family.
Advantages and disadvantages of glass thermometers
-
It only gives estimated results , not as accurate as an electronic thermometer.
-
It reacts more slowly to changes in air temperature, so you'll need to wait longer for a stable reading.
-
Suitable when you only need to refer to the room temperature at an approximate level and don't require detailed data.

Step 3: Use a bimetallic thermometer when you need one that is easy to read or for decorative purposes.
How bimetallic thermometers work
Bimetallic thermometers use a double metal strip inside.
-
As the room temperature increases, the metal strip expands and bends.
-
This bending causes the needle on the clock face to rotate to the corresponding temperature.
-
Looking at the needle, you can immediately know the room temperature without any further action.
Advantages of bimetallic thermometers
-
Easily visible from a distance thanks to its large dial and prominent hands.
-
No batteries required, unaffected by electronic interference.
-
There are many styles: compass-like, clock-like, sundial-like… suitable for decorating living rooms, offices or shops.
Disadvantages to note
-
Their accuracy is not as high as electronic thermometers; they are only suitable for quick reference.
-
Its slower response to temperature changes makes it unsuitable for intensive monitoring needs.
When should you choose a bimetallic thermometer?
-
When you want a device that's easy to observe , and can be viewed even from a distance.
-
When you prioritize aesthetics , decoration, or need a simple measuring device that doesn't rely on a power source.

Step 4: How to position the thermometer in the room for accurate readings.
Place the thermometer in the center of the room.
This method reduces errors and accurately reflects the actual room temperature .
-
Place the thermometer in the middle of the room , not too close to a wall or corner.
-
Keep away from drafty areas such as windows, doors, or fans.
Keep the thermometer at a minimum height of 60 cm.
This height is equivalent to the human sitting position, which helps to stabilize the measurements.
-
Place the thermometer on a table , shelf , or stool to avoid the cold air from the floor.
-
Do not place the thermometer directly on the floor because the floor is usually colder than the air.
Avoid direct sunlight and heat sources.
Light or heat-emitting devices can distort the results.
-
Avoid placing it near a window where sunlight shines in.
-
Avoid placing it near air conditioners, heaters, or other operating electrical appliances.

Step 5: Wait for the thermometer to stabilize before reading the result.
Allow the thermometer to acclimate to room temperature for about 5 minutes.
Most thermometers need time to stabilize before displaying the correct room temperature .
-
After placing the thermometer in the correct position, wait at least 5 minutes for the device to acclimate.
-
Avoid standing too close, as body heat can skew the results.
-
Glass and bimetallic thermometers typically take longer to react to changes in air temperature.
Electronic thermometers display readings faster.
-
Electronic thermometers typically provide results in just 1–2 minutes and are highly reliable.
-
If you need to monitor room temperature regularly or want quick results, an electronic thermometer is a more suitable option.

Step 6: How to correctly read room temperature readings
Do not handle or touch the thermometer when reading the result.
Keep the thermometer on a table or shelf so that the temperature from your hand doesn't distort the reading.
-
Make sure you stand a little distance away so that your body heat doesn't affect the room temperature.
-
This is a crucial step to obtaining the most accurate measurement results.
The room temperature is considered comfortable.
-
Most adults feel comfortable within the range of 18–24°C (64–75°F) .
-
If the room temperature is outside this range, you may consider adjusting the air conditioner, heater, or ventilation.
How to read each type of thermometer
Electronic thermometer
-
Look directly at the number displayed on the screen .
-
This is the most accurate result, least susceptible to environmental factors.
Glass thermometer
-
Position your eyes level with the top of the liquid column in the tube.
-
Read the number or mark closest to the top of the liquid column to determine the room temperature .
-
Avoid looking from above or below to prevent getting the wrong angle.
Bimetallic thermometer
-
Observe the hands on the clock face.
-
Read the number or mark that the hands are pointing to, similar to how you would read a traditional analog watch.

Tip 3: Ideal room temperature for sleep and health
Question 1: What is the ideal room temperature to maintain in a house?
Keep most rooms at 18–24°C (64–75°F).
This temperature range is considered suitable for most adults and is recommended by many health organizations, including the WHO.
-
18°C is the minimum temperature for healthy adults when wearing appropriate seasonal clothing.
-
This is the ideal temperature for the living room or family room – where people often sit, relax, watch TV, or chat.
Adjust the temperature higher for sensitive individuals.
Some groups need to be kept warmer to avoid health problems.
-
The elderly.
-
Young children.
-
People who are sick or have weakened immune systems.
In these cases, the minimum temperature should be raised to around 20°C (68°F) to ensure safety and comfort.

Question 2: What is the ideal bedroom temperature for deeper sleep?
Keep the bedroom temperature between 15–19°C (60–67°F).
Cool temperatures help the body feel sleepy more easily because body temperature naturally decreases when entering the resting phase.
-
This temperature is recommended by many sleep experts because it helps you fall asleep faster.
-
If the room is too hot or too cold, the body has to adjust a lot, making it difficult to fall asleep or sleep soundly.

Question 3: What should the bathroom temperature be maintained at?
Keep the bathroom warmer, around 22°C (71°F).
Bathrooms need a higher temperature than other rooms so you don't get a sudden chill when you step out of the shower or bathtub.
-
The large temperature difference between warm water and cold air can be detrimental to health.
-
22°C helps the body maintain a comfortable state, especially when using the bathroom at night or early in the morning.
Why should bathrooms be warmer?
-
After a warm bath, the body is very sensitive to cold air, easily causing shivering, vasoconstriction, or discomfort.
-
A warmer environment also reduces excessive condensation, helping to keep the bathroom less humid and cleaner.

Question 4: What is the ideal temperature setting for energy saving in the summer?
Keep your home temperature around 26°C (78°F) to reduce your electricity bill.
During the hot season, setting the air conditioner temperature a little higher is a significant way to save on cooling costs while still maintaining comfort.
-
Many energy agencies recommend a temperature of 26°C as it is suitable for daytime activities.
-
When sleeping, you can lower it slightly to make it easier to fall asleep.
-
When you're away from home for extended periods, set your air conditioner a little higher to reduce electricity consumption.
Why does setting a higher temperature help save energy?
-
The smaller the temperature difference between the inside and outside of the house, the less the air conditioner needs to work.
-
Reducing the load on your air conditioner means lower electricity bills and a longer lifespan for the appliance.

Question 5: What is the ideal temperature setting for energy saving in winter?
Maintain daytime temperatures around 20°C (68°F).
During the cold season, maintaining your home temperature at 20°C will keep you warm enough while saving energy.
-
This temperature is suitable for daytime activities while the body is still active.
-
When going to bed or going out for an extended period, you can lower the temperature by a few more degrees to further save electricity.
For long trips lasting several days: maintain a minimum temperature of 10°C (50°F).
If you're leaving home for a few days or weeks in the winter, you shouldn't turn off the heating system completely.
-
The temperature should be kept at a minimum of 10°C to prevent the pipes from freezing and cracking.
-
This temperature is low enough to save electricity while still ensuring the safety of the household water system.

The most comfortable temperature range for most people.
If you feel it's "just right," the room temperature is usually around 22–24°C (72–76°F).
This is the temperature range within which most of the human body can naturally radiate heat and maintain a stable body temperature around 37°C .
-
When the room temperature is within this range, you generally won't feel too hot or too cold.
-
This temperature range is also ideal for light activities such as reading, working, watching TV, or daily routines.
Why is a temperature of around 22–24°C considered the most comfortable?
-
The body doesn't need to expend much energy to regulate its temperature.
-
A stable circadian rhythm helps you feel more relaxed and focused.
-
Suitable for most adults in normal living environments.
